George Mason University seeks a highly strategic and service-oriented Senior Event and Client Experience Manager to lead executive, academic, governmental, and industry conferences and events at Mason Square. Reporting to the Director of Administration and Operations, this position serves as the senior leader responsible for oversight of the event management pipeline, executive client experience, operational standards, and scalable service delivery across a growing portfolio of high-profile conferences, convenings, and campus engagements. This role establishes and operationalizes event management standards, client service frameworks, service packages, workflow practices, performance measures, forecasting tools, and staffing models that support both operational excellence and long-term growth. The position partners closely with executive leadership, academic units, government agencies, and external stakeholders to position Mason Square as a premier destination for executive industry and academic conferences, innovation, and regional engagement. The Senior Event and Client Experience Manager will also lead modernization efforts through reporting, automation, AI-enabled workflows, and operational analytics that improve service delivery, increase efficiency, and inform strategic decision-making. Responsibilities: Executive Event & Conference Leadership Provides strategic leadership and operational oversight for executive-level conferences, academic convenings, industry partnerships, presidential engagements, and institutional events; Leads development and implementation of event management standards, operating procedures, communication protocols, and service expectations; Serves as a leader for the event management pipeline to ensure consistent client experience, accountability, transparency, and operational execution; Establishes performance metrics and service benchmarks related to responsiveness, client satisfaction, operational effectiveness, revenue generation, and staff performance; Serves as senior advisor to clients and campus partners regarding event strategy, feasibility, logistics, scheduling, and execution; Leads post-event evaluation and continuous improvement initiatives informed by operational analytics and client feedback; Serves as escalation point for complex client issues, operational challenges, and high-profile engagements; Partners with university stakeholders and external vendors to deliver seamless event experiences; and Develops executive briefings, readiness protocols, and run-of-show standards to ensure consistent delivery. Service Strategy, Analytics & Revenue Growth Leads development and refinement of tiered event management service offerings aligned with client needs, operational capacity, and institutional priorities; Partners with the Director to design and market service packages and recharge methodologies, staffing assumptions, pricing models, and cost recovery strategies; Establishes annual revenue goals and identifies opportunities for expanded service offerings and premium support models; Develops forecasting tools and reporting frameworks that measure event complexity, staffing demand, service utilization, and operational performance; Manages dashboards and performance reporting to support staffing decisions, resource allocation, budgeting, and long-range planning; Partners with marketing and communications teams to develop and execute strategies that increase awareness, promote campus venues and services, and support client acquisition, engagement, and retention; Leads the development and integration of AI-assisted reporting, workflow automation, and operational modernization initiatives; and Partners with university stakeholders to establish, implement, and continuously improve operational standards, service models, and best practices that enhance consistency, efficiency, and the overall client experience. Operational Leadership & Team Development Provides leadership and performance oversight for professional and part-time event management staff; Establishes training, onboarding, and operational playbooks to support scalable and consistent service delivery; Fosters a culture of accountability, innovation, collaboration, and continuous improvement; Develops staffing recommendations aligned with service demand and organizational priorities; and Provides proactive coaching, mentorship, and performance management to foster accountability, address performance concerns, and drive continuous improvement. Required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Communications, Hospitality, Event Management, or related field (or equivalent experience); Progressively responsible experience (typically 7–10+ years) in executive event management, conference operations, public relations, higher education events, or large-scale venue operations; Demonstrated experience managing executive-level, academic, governmental, or industry conferences; Experience supervising staff and leading complex operational workflows in fast-paced environments; Strong experience in staffing strategy and operational planning; Experience with enterprise event systems (25Live, Cvent, Social Tables, or similar platforms); Strong analytical, communication, and executive stakeholder management skills; and Demonstrated success establishing service standards, KPIs, operating procedures, and client experience frameworks. Preferred Qualifications: Master’s degree in a related field; Professional certifications preferred (CMP, PMP, CTS, or related); Experience within higher education, conference centers, executive education, innovation districts, or public-private partnership environments; Experience implementing automation, AI-enabled workflows, business intelligence tools, or operational reporting solutions; Experience supporting executive-level or presidential events; Knowledge of university operational policies and event governance practices; and Project management skills, including budget oversight, facilities coordination, logistical planning, and event management.
